About the Ransomhouse group

RansomHouse is a double-extortion RaaS operation active since late 2021, attributed to the threat actor "Jolly Scorpius," targeting over 120 organizations across healthcare, finance, transportation, and government, recently upgrading to a multi-layered dual-key encryption architecture. Ransomhouse has listed 206 victims since June 2021.

Incident Analysis

GuangDong South Land pharmaceutical was targeted by Ransomhouse ransomware, one of the most active ransomware groups in our database with 148 confirmed victims globally. The attack was disclosed on November 25, 2024, when GuangDong South Land pharmaceutical appeared on the group's dark web leak site.

GuangDong South Land pharmaceutical is based in China , operating in the Healthcare sector. China ranks #26 globally for ransomware attacks, with 122 victims in our database.

Sector context: Healthcare organisations are high-value ransomware targets because patient data is extremely sensitive, regulatory penalties for breaches are severe, and operational downtime can threaten patient safety β€” all factors that increase ransom payment pressure.

Ransomhouse typically employs a double extortion model: first exfiltrating sensitive data from the victim's systems, then deploying ransomware to encrypt files. Victims face two simultaneous threats β€” paying to restore access and paying to prevent publication of stolen data. The group's leak site publishes victim names and exfiltrated data as leverage.

How can organisations protect against Ransomhouse attacks?

To defend against Ransomhouse and similar threat actors, organisations should: maintain regular offline backups tested for restoration; implement network segmentation to limit lateral movement; deploy multi-factor authentication on all remote access; use endpoint detection and response (EDR) tools; conduct regular phishing and security awareness training; and monitor threat intelligence feeds for indicators of compromise (IOCs) associated with active groups.
